online advertising measures

Definition

Five basic measures are: (1) Visitor, someone who voluntarily connects to a website. Advertisers try to get visitors' names, age, gender, address (or zip code), visit frequency, preferences, usage patterns, etc. (2) Visit, act of the visitor connecting to the website. Any uninterrupted visit (no matter how short or long) is considered one visit. (3) Page view, what pages were viewed or requested by the visitor. (4) Ad view, number of page views multiplied by the number of ads on each page. (5) Click, visitor clicking mouse button on a linked object (the ad that carries the visitor to the advertiser's website).
